The Ark to Jerusalem 2 Samuel 6:1-23
n The Months
n Afraid of the LORD that day-Renewed Respect for Power & Holiness
n Aside into the house of Obededom-Closest Levite House (1 Chron 15:16-18)
n Gittite three months…and the LORD blessed-In the Form of Multiplied Children (1 Chron 26:8)
n The Mad Wife
n David’s Celebration
n Brought up the ark…into the city of David-Levites Carried It Scripturally
n Had gone six paces, he sacrificed-May Be Symbolic of Sabbath Rest & Consecration of the Whole Trip
n David danced before the LORD-To Spring Around in Half Circles
n David was girded with a linen ephod-Clothing Reserved for Priests & Levites
n Wearing the Ephod Suggests David Had the Title of a Priest
n He Got That Status By Taking Jerusalem, the Home of Melchizedek (Gen 14:8)
n This Title Applied to David, As Well As to One of His Descendants-Christ (Heb 7:14-21)n Michal…despised him in her heart-Michal’s Objection Was That it Was Unbefitting a King
n Tabernacle that David had pitched for it-Erected a Special Tent (1 Chr 16:39-40)
n End of offering…he blessed the people-Another Priestly Act (Gen 14:18-19)
n Michal’s Condemnation
n How glorious was the king of Israel-Spoke in the Third Person
n Uncovered himself-He Took Off His Royal Robe & Appeared Inferior
n It was before the LORD-The Celebration Was Not For the Women (1 Cor 4:10)
n Maidservants…of them shall I be had in honor-Upon Reflection, We Are All Nothing in God’s Presence-Humility
n Michal the daughter of Saul had no child-Barrenness Interpreted as the Lord’s Disapproval & End of Saul’s House
